The Importance of Early Treatment for Hemangiomas Another noteworthy session was led by Dr. Jim Treat, who highlighted urgent updates regarding the management of hemangiomas. Speaking on the critical need for timely intervention, Treat asserted, “There are new clinical guidelines for hemangiomas. The bottom line is, get them into treatment as soon as possible.” This promptness is vital as hemangiomas have a rapid growth phase in early life, making early diagnosis and intervention essential in avoiding complications. His insights resonate with the overarching theme of the conference: the integration of updated clinical practices into everyday dermatological care. Update Setting the Standard: Safety in Medical SpasThe medical spa industry is on a rapid growth trajectory, with projections suggesting the U.S. market will reach a staggering $11.1 billion by 2028. As consumers increasingly seek non-invasive treatments for aesthetic enhancements, the focus on patient safety is paramount. Forward-thinking providers understand that prioritizing safety not only builds trust with clients but also serves as a competitive advantage in a crowded marketplace.The Case for Proactive Safety MeasuresRecent legal developments, such as Texas's Jenifer’s Law that mandates licensed professionals for IV therapy, highlight the importance of pre-emptively implementing rigorous safety standards.
